When the Boston Bruins traded Milan Lucic just before the start of the 2015 Entry Draft, the fans were upset. Don Sweeney had made a few moves that appeared baffling to the B’s fan base. As the day progressed, the Lucic trade began making more and more sense to most Bruins fans. The B’s couldn’t afford to keep Lucic, and they were able to get a first round pick and backup goaltender Martin Jones from the Los Angeles Kings. It turned out to be the ‘better’ deal of the Bruins two big moves on draft day.
